Sodium Nitroprusside Dihydrate CAS 13755-38-9
- CAS: 13755-38-9
- Synonyms: Sodium nitroprusside dihydrate; Sodium nitroferricyanide; Sodium pentacyanonitrosylferrate
- Einecs: 238-373-9
- Molecular Formula: Na₂[Fe(CN)₅NO]·2H₂O

Q:
Why is light protection important for Sodium Nitroprusside Dihydrate?
A: Sodium nitroprusside is light-sensitive, so the supplied material and any solutions should be protected from unnecessary light exposure. Confirm light-protection requirements, packaging and storage conditions from the current product-specific specification and handling requirements. -

Q:
What appearance, solubility and stability should be expected for Sodium Nitroprusside Dihydrate?
A: Sodium nitroprusside dihydrate CAS 13755-38-9 is normally a red or ruby-red transparent crystalline solid, molecular weight 297.95, with density about 1.71-1.72 g/cm3 and water solubility about 400 g/L at 20 C, though it slowly decomposes. Aqueous solutions are unstable and may turn blue or green, especially on light or heat exposure, so confirm the supplied hydrate form and protect it from light.
